nasai-kubra:11531Isḥāq b. Ibrāhīm > Yaḥyá b. Ādam > Mālik b. Mighwal > Wāṣil al-Aḥdab > Abū Wāʾil > Ḥudhayfah

[Machine] The hypocrites were asked: Are they more today or during the time of the Messenger of Allah ﷺ? He said, "Rather, they are more today; because at that time they used to conceal it, and today they openly express it."  

الكبرى للنسائي:١١٥٣١أَخْبَرَنَا إِسْحَاقُ بْنُ إِبْرَاهِيمَ قَالَ أَخْبَرَنَا يَحْيَى بْنُ آدَمَ قَالَ حَدَّثَنَا مَالِكُ بْنُ مِغْوَلٍ عَنْ وَاصِلٍ الْأَحْدَبِ عَنْ أَبِي وَائِلٍ عَنْ حُذَيْفَةَ قَالَ

قِيلَ لَهُ الْمُنَافِقُونَ الْيَوْمَ أَكْثَرُ أَمْ عَلَى عَهْدِ رَسُولِ اللهِ ﷺ؟ قَالَ «بَلْ هُمُ الْيَوْمَ أَكْثَرُ؛ لِأَنَّهُ كَانَ يَوْمَئِذٍ يَسْتَسِرُّونَهُ وَالْيَوْمَ يَسْتَعْلِنُونَهُ»
